EASY SAVOY CABBAGE

I love savoy cabbage and we serve it as a side to almost anything. This is one of my favorite ways to make it, quick and easy with a little butter and cream.

Steps:

  • Place savoy cabbage in a pot, cover with cold water, and bring to a boil. Cook for 1 minute, remove from heat, and drain. Rinse under cold water. Squeeze savoy cabbage as dry as possible with your hands.
  • Melt butter in a pot and add savoy cabbage. Add cream and season with salt, pepper, and nutmeg. Cook until cabbage is soft and creamy, 2 to 4 minutes.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 188.9 calories, Carbohydrate 14.2 g, Cholesterol 43.3 mg, Fat 14.4 g, Fiber 7 g, Protein 4.9 g, SaturatedFat 9 g, Sodium 168.8 mg, Sugar 5.2 g

1 head savoy cabbage, sliced
3 tablespoons butter
¼ cup heavy whipping cream, or to taste
sal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
⅛ teaspoon ground nutmeg, or to taste

SAUTEED CABBAGE

I grew up on smothered cabbage, but I think this one can beat them all...tender-crisp and fast. See note for caraway.

Steps:

  • In a saute or frying pan on medium-high heat, melt butter. Add chopped garlic and stir until fragrant, about 1 minute. Do not burn garlic. Add shredded cabbage to garlic and butter, tossing to coat.
  • Season with salt and pepper and continue to cook cabbage, tossing occassionally until it just begins to turn golden, about 10-15 minutes.
  • Note: Caraway is a great addition. Add 1/2 teaspoon with the garlic and stir until fragrant.

1/2 head green cabbage, shredded thin
2 cloves garlic, chopped
2 tablespoons butter
salt and pepper

Steps:

  • Chop scallions, reserving white and dark green parts separately.
  • Cook scallion whites and garlic in oil in a 12-inch heavy skillet over medium-high heat, stirring occasionally, until garlic is pale golden, about 3 minutes. Stir in cabbage, 3/4 teaspoon salt, and 1/4 teaspoon pepper and sauté 1 minute. Add water and cook, tightly covered, until cabbage is wilted, about 3 minutes. Add scallion greens and cook, uncovered, stirring, until most of water has evaporated and cabbage is tender, about 2 minutes. Season with salt and pepper.

1 bunch scallions
2 garlic cloves, chopped
3 tablespoons olive oil
1 pound Savoy cabbage, cored and thinly sliced (8 cups)
1/4 cup water

Steps:

  • Bring 2 quarts of water to a boil and add 1 tablespoon salt. Add the cabbage and blanch for 1 minute. Drain the cabbage in a colander, refresh under cold running water until cool, and reserve.
  • Put the bacon in a large skillet and cook over medium heat until the fat is rendered, 4 to 5 minutes. Pour off all but 1 tablespoon of the fat. Add the onion and sage and cook, stirring, until the onion is wilted but not browned, about 10 minutes. Add the blanched cabbage and cook for 2 more minutes. Stir in the flour and cook, stirring, 3 minutes. Pour in the stock, bring to a boil, reduce the heat, and cook until thickened, 2 to 3 more minutes. Season with 1/2 teaspoon salt and the pepper and serve.

Kosher salt
2 medium heads Savoy cabbage, coarse outer leaves, core, and ribs removed, cut into 1-inch dice (10 cups)
4 ounces bacon, sliced crosswise into 1-inch pieces (3/4 cup)
3 cups thinly sliced white onions
2 tablespoons chopped fresh sage
1 tablespoon all-purpose flour
2 cups chicken stock, homemade or store-bought
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per

SAUTéED CABBAGE AND ONIONS

Steps:

  • I find that when I buy a good-sized green cabbage and use a small amount in a recipe, the remainder often languishes in the fridge. This is an ideal way to use up green cabbage while it still has some flavor. For this preparation, you can use half or even most of a cabbage. In a large skillet or stir-fry pan, sauté a quartered and thinly sliced onion in some olive oil. When it starts to turn golden, stir in thinly sliced cabbage. Cook, covered, until the cabbage wilts. If the pan dries out, add just enough water to moisten. Once the cabbage is wilted, uncover and cook until both the cabbage and onion begin to brown, stirring frequently. Add a sprinkling of poppy seeds, if you like.

STIR-FRIED SAVOY CABBAGE

A simple dish full of vitamin C and folic acid and ideal on the side of your Sunday roast

Steps:

  • Steam or boil the cabbage for 3-4 mins until just tender, then drain well. If doing ahead of time, cool under running water and chill until ready to stir-fry.
  • Heat the oil in a wok or large frying pan. Add the garlic and seeds and cook for 1 min until beginning to turn golden. Toss in the cabbage and stir-fry over the highest heat for 3-4 mins. Season with a little sea salt and serve.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 61 calories, Fat 3 grams fat, Carbohydrate 6 grams carbohydrates, Sugar 6 grams sugar, Fiber 5 grams fiber, Protein 3 grams protein, Sodium 0.02 milligram of sodium

1 large Savoy cabbage , thinly sliced
1 tbsp olive oil
2 garlic cloves , thinly sliced
1 tsp fennel or caraway seeds
